  • Gourmet Sampling: Includes five tastings of food and one wine tasting, giving a broad taste of Santa Barbara’s local flavors.
  • Insider Access: Guides are knowledgeable and friendly, offering real insights into the city’s history, architecture, and culture.
  • Landmark Highlights: Key sites like the Santa Barbara County Courthouse and Arlington Theatre are part of the walk, blending history with local charm.
  • Small Group: With a maximum of 14 travelers, expect a personalized, engaging experience.
  • Flexible & Convenient: Tour is scheduled for 11:00 am, starting at a central location, with the round-up near Barden Winery.
  • Weather-Ready: Operates in all weather conditions, so dress appropriately, and be prepared for a fair amount of walking.

Is the tour suitable for vegetarians?
Yes, vegetarian options are available. Just let the tour operator know at the time of booking so they can accommodate your dietary needs.

How long does the tour last?
The tour lasts approximately 3 hours and 30 minutes, making it a comfortable length for an afternoon activity.

Where does the tour start and end?
It begins at 1317 State St, Santa Barbara, and ends near Barden Winery at 32 El Paseo, Santa Barbara.

What is included in the price?
The tour includes five food tastings, one wine tasting, a guided walk with insights into Santa Barbara’s history and architecture, and the company of professional local guides.

Are there any restrictions on children?
Yes, the tour is not recommended for children aged 8 and under, and toddlers are at your own risk.

What should I wear?
Dress appropriately for all weather conditions and wear comfortable shoes suitable for walking.

Can I cancel if my plans change?
Yes, free cancellation is available up to 24 hours in advance for a full refund, making it flexible if your plans shift.
